Our tape is cut a little bit narrower than most calls, Sam designed his own die for his tape cutter.  Currently, all of our production calls are standard sized, but he will make youth framed calls and has 3 or for "recipes" that are really good in the smaller frame. The tape size will still be the same.  You'll need to give Sam a call or shoot him an email to order youth frame calls.
